Output 50a5230790355e8feba258d52da1fc681adac349297ebd3f4dd2b21816bdd50b:2
- value
- 690300000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2a5758394fe659318aa92b22e987c1b7f0f8aa9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MfPvef5YQa9W83L5Srfq6v8sAPbczFReJ
- transaction
- 50a5230790355e8feba258d52da1fc681adac349297ebd3f4dd2b21816bdd50b